Get in Touch** The Volvo repair market serving Helen, WV, is characterized by a limited number of highly specialized independent shops, as there are no Volvo dealerships in the immediate vicinity. The closest authorized Volvo retailers are located in Morgantown, WV, or out-of-state, making the independent specialists in Clarksburg and Bridgeport the primary and most practical resource for owners. The average quality of these top-tier independents is high, with technicians often having prior dealership experience. Competition is moderate; while there are few Volvo-specific shops, they compete with general repair shops and the allure of distant dealerships. This keeps pricing competitive but still at a premium compared to non-specialist repairs, reflecting the required expertise, proprietary diagnostic software, and cost of OEM parts. Typical pricing for a standard service ranges from $120-$180 per hour for labor. For residents of Helen, planning for a day trip to Clarksburg or Bridgeport for major service is a standard expectation.

While Helen is a small community, specialized Volvo service is available in nearby larger towns like Clarksburg or Bridgeport. It's recommended to call ahead to confirm a shop's experience with your specific Volvo model, as general mechanics may not have the proprietary tools or software for complex diagnostics.
Given West Virginia's hilly terrain and winter road salt, common issues include premature brake wear, suspension component fatigue, and undercarriage corrosion. Volvo's all-wheel-drive systems may also require more frequent servicing due to constant use on winding and steep local roads.
Beyond standard warning lights, pay attention to symptoms like difficulty starting in cold weather, reduced braking power on hills, or unusual noises from the suspension on rough roads. For urgent issues, it's best to contact a shop in Clarksburg for diagnosis rather than waiting, as local towing options in Helen may be limited.
Look for shops that are ASE-certified and advertise specific European or Volvo expertise. Check for online reviews mentioning Volvo service and ask if they use genuine or OEM-quality parts and have access to Volvo-specific diagnostic software (VIDA), which is crucial for accurate repairs.
Labor rates may be slightly lower than national averages, but parts costs remain consistent. Budgeting should account for the challenging driving conditions, which can accelerate wear. Establishing a relationship with a trusted local shop for preventative maintenance is the most cost-effective strategy to avoid major repairs.
